COQUITLAM (NEWS 1130) – There’s a surprise visitor at the Coquitlam Central station this morning.
A bear cub was spotted in a tree near the West Coast Express platform.
“They believe the mom is somewhere close by because they heard some rustling in the bushes. So the key is to try to get her safely connected with her cub,” said RCMP Constable Jennifer Goodings.
Conservation officers did head to the station, but they weren’t needed, as the animals left on their own.
The situation didn’t have any impact on transit.
“After we noticed this was happening, we kept our passengers outside of the station until the train arrived and then we just loaded them directly,” says Chris Bryan with TransLink.
